If you follow the Greater Tampa Chamber of Commerce on Twitter, you may have noticed the tweet posted by the organization last week:

How to start a small business in #Tampa. And then a link to a page on the City of Tampa's website, claiming that, “starting a small business in Tampa is as easy as 1-2-3.”

The listed steps are:

• Register the name of your business.

• Obtain your City of Tampa Business Tax license and your Hillsborough County Occupational License.

• File for Sales Tax Collection with the State of Florida if your business qualifies.

Perhaps this is useful to an entrepreneur — although there is a tad more involved in starting a business.

But Coffee Talk can't help but notice all this “helpfulness” involves government getting taxes. It rather seems more like: “Easy as 1-2-3, taxes flow from you to me!”
